Hurricane Beryl Disaster Assistance Available

FEMA Disaster Assistance

Galveston and Harris County residents are eligible for FEMA Disaster Assistance and can apply online at disasterassistance.gov or by calling 800-621-3362.

FEMA's Individual Assistance program funding assists with expenses such as temporary housing, emergency home repairs, uninsured and underinsured personal property losses, disaster legal services, disaster unemployment assistance, and medical, dental, and funeral expenses caused by the disaster.

Disaster Loans

Due to President Biden's major disaster declaration, low-interest federal disaster loans are now available to Texas businesses and residents.

Disaster loans up to $500,000 are available to homeowners to repair or replace damaged or destroyed real estate. Homeowners and renters are eligible for up to $100,000 to repair or replace damaged or destroyed personal property, including personal vehicles.

Businesses of all sizes and private nonprofit organizations may borrow up to $2 million to repair or replace damaged or destroyed real estate, machinery and equipment, inventory, and other business assets. SBA can also lend additional funds to help with the cost of improvements to protect, prevent, or minimize disaster damage from occurring in the future
